Surface tension of soap solution is `2 xx 10^(-2) N//m` . The work done in producing a soap bubble of radius 2 cm is

A

`64pi xx 10^(-6) J`

B

`32pi xx 10^(-6) J`

C

`16 pi xx 10^(-6) J`

D

`8 pi xx 10^(-6) J`

Text Solution

Verified by Experts

The correct Answer is:
A
